Off Piste Skiing in Val d'Isere |
Val d'Isere is a resort that boasts a unique microclimate due to its location, high up in the French alps and tucked away near the Italian border the resort is a snow sure destination. The off piste skiing beats all other resorts hands down. The four main skiing areas of, La Daille, Bellevarde, Solaise and Le Fornet are only a snippet of the entrance ways to the massive off piste skiing areas that are at our disposal. The off piste skiing is so good, partly because the lift system enables you to access it without too much bother, occasionally it is necessary to walk on ski skins to access better and more sheltered off piste routes, this is always a pleasure as the snow is excellent further afield and the views are simply majestic. Leaving your fresh tracks in deep fresh snow is one of the best feelings and the opportunities to do this don't get any better than in the l'espace killy. With the neighboring resort of Tignes nearby, daily off piste adventures are not to be missed.
